JAGUARS’ MINTER EARNS INVITATION TO NFLPA COLLEGIATE BOWL

MOBILE, Ala. – University of South Alabama running back Tra Minter announced on Monday that he has accepted an invitation to play in the NFLPA Collegiate Bowl in January.

The game will take place on Saturday, Jan. 18, 2020, at the Rose Bowl and is set to kick off at 6 p.m. (CST) on the NFL Network.  Leading the two teams in the contest will be former National Football League head coaches Hue Jackson and Marvin Lewis.

With two games left in his senior season, Minter has rushed for 881 yards and four scores on 154 carries while catching 27 passes for 193 yards.  The Jaguars' primary return specialist, he has also run back 26 kickoffs for 512 yards giving the running back 1,604 all-purpose yards on the year.  He currently stands second on the school's season record list for all-purpose yards and is third in rushing.

Not only does Minter lead the Sun Belt Conference in all-purpose yards per game — ranking fifth nationally in the category — but he is fifth in the league in rushing yards per contest and stands third with an average of 19.69 yards per kick return.

In nearly three full seasons at South, Minter has accumulated 2,023 yards rushing, 1,310 yards on kickoff returns and 4,083 all-purpose yards to rank among the top three in all three statistics in USA's career record book.

He is the first Jag to be invited to play in the postseason all-star game since Brandon Bridge participated in 2015.

Minter and the Jaguars will be back in action Saturday with a 1 p.m. contest at Georgia State.
